The Benefits Of Electronic Invoicing: Streamlining The Billing Process

In today’s fast-paced business world, efficiency and automation are key components to success. One area where technological advancements have greatly improved efficiency is in the realm of invoicing. electronic invoicing, also known as e-invoicing, has revolutionized the way businesses send and receive invoices, making the billing process faster, more accurate, and more cost-effective. In this article, we will explore the benefits of electronic invoicing and how it can streamline the billing process for businesses of all sizes.

electronic invoicing is the process of sending and receiving invoices in a digital format, rather than through traditional paper-based methods. This can be done through email, a web portal, or through specialized electronic invoicing platforms. By eliminating the need for paper invoices, businesses can save time, reduce errors, and lower costs associated with printing and mailing paper invoices.

One of the key benefits of electronic invoicing is the speed at which invoices can be sent and received. With traditional paper invoices, there is a delay between the time an invoice is generated and the time it reaches the recipient. This delay can lead to delays in payment, which can impact a business’s cash flow. With electronic invoicing, invoices can be sent instantly, allowing businesses to receive payments faster and improve their overall cash flow.

Another benefit of electronic invoicing is the reduction in errors and disputes. Paper invoices are susceptible to errors such as typos, miscalculations, and missing information. These errors can lead to disputes between businesses and their customers, resulting in delays in payment and strained relationships. electronic invoicing systems can help reduce these errors by automatically populating fields, performing calculations, and flagging missing information before an invoice is sent. This can help businesses avoid costly disputes and ensure that invoices are paid on time.

Electronic invoicing also offers businesses a more cost-effective way to manage their billing process. Traditional paper-based invoicing methods can be expensive, requiring businesses to purchase paper, ink, envelopes, and stamps. Additionally, the time spent printing, mailing, and processing paper invoices can add up to significant costs. By switching to electronic invoicing, businesses can save money on printing and mailing costs, reduce the time spent on manual processes, and free up resources to focus on more strategic initiatives.

In addition to cost savings, electronic invoicing can also help businesses improve their sustainability efforts. The use of paper invoices contributes to deforestation, water pollution, and greenhouse gas emissions. By switching to electronic invoicing, businesses can reduce their environmental impact and demonstrate their commitment to sustainability. This can be an important selling point for businesses looking to attract environmentally conscious customers and investors.

Furthermore, electronic invoicing can improve transparency and visibility into the billing process. Electronic invoicing platforms often provide businesses with real-time access to their invoices, allowing them to track the status of payments, monitor outstanding balances, and analyze payment trends. This level of visibility can help businesses make more informed decisions about their cash flow, identify opportunities for improvement, and streamline their billing process.

It is important to note that while electronic invoicing offers many benefits, businesses must ensure that they comply with relevant regulations and data security standards when implementing electronic invoicing solutions. This includes keeping sensitive financial information secure, ensuring the authenticity and integrity of electronic invoices, and complying with tax laws and regulations related to electronic invoicing.

The Versatile Thread Screw: A Comprehensive Guide

thread screws, also known as machine screws, are a versatile and essential piece of hardware used in a wide range of applications. From construction projects to everyday household repairs, these small but mighty fasteners play a crucial role in holding things together securely. In this article, we will explore what thread screws are, how they work, and the various types available in the market.

At its core, a thread screw is a type of fastener that features an externally threaded shank and a blunt end. They are designed to be driven into pre-drilled holes with the help of a screwdriver or a power tool, allowing them to create a strong, durable connection. thread screws come in a variety of sizes and materials, each suited for different tasks and environments.

One of the key characteristics of thread screws is their threading, which allows them to grip the surrounding material securely. The threads on a screw are helical ridges that wrap around the shank, providing traction and ensuring that the screw stays in place once it is fastened. The shape and spacing of these threads can vary depending on the type of screw, with some having coarse threads for quicker installation, while others have fine threads for increased holding power.

thread screws are commonly used in woodworking, metalworking, and construction projects, where a reliable and long-lasting connection is essential. They are often used to join two or more pieces of material together, such as attaching hinges to doors, fastening electrical components, or securing fixtures to walls. Thread screws are also used in automotive and machinery applications, where they play a crucial role in holding critical components in place.

One of the main advantages of thread screws is their versatility. With a wide range of sizes and types available, there is a screw for virtually any application. Phillips head screws, for example, are popular for their ease of use and compatibility with most screwdrivers. Flathead screws, on the other hand, are preferred for applications where a flush finish is desired. Other types of thread screws include hex head screws, socket head screws, and pan head screws, each with its own set of pros and cons.

When choosing a thread screw for a particular task, it is essential to consider the material of the screw and the material it will be fastened into. Different materials offer varying levels of strength and corrosion resistance, so it is important to select the right screw for the job. For example, stainless steel screws are ideal for outdoor applications where exposure to moisture and sunlight is a concern, while zinc-plated screws offer excellent protection against rust and corrosion.

In addition to material considerations, the length and diameter of the thread screw are also crucial factors to take into account. The length of the screw should be sufficient to penetrate both the material being fastened and the underlying surface, ensuring a secure connection. The diameter of the screw should be compatible with the hole size to prevent stripping or damage to the surrounding material.

Mastering A Levels In Just 1 Year: Is It Possible?

A Levels are a crucial stage in the British education system, serving as the gateway to higher education and career opportunities. Typically, students spend two years studying for their A Levels in various subjects before taking their exams. However, there is another option available for those looking to fast-track their education: the 1 year A Level program.

1 year A level programs allow students to complete their A Levels in just one year instead of the usual two. This accelerated timeline can be appealing to students who are looking to move on to university or the workforce sooner rather than later. But is it really possible to master A Levels in just 12 months? Let’s take a closer look at the pros and cons of this option.

One of the main advantages of the 1 year A Level program is the time-saving aspect. By condensing the curriculum into a shorter timeframe, students can complete their studies more quickly and move on to the next stage of their education or career. This can be especially beneficial for students who are eager to start university or enter the workforce as soon as possible.

Additionally, the 1 year A Level program can be a good option for students who are confident in their academic abilities and are willing to put in the extra effort required to succeed in an accelerated program. By focusing solely on their A Level subjects for a year, students can fully immerse themselves in the material and potentially achieve higher grades than they would in a traditional two-year program.

However, there are also some drawbacks to completing A Levels in just one year. One of the main challenges is the intense workload that comes with an accelerated program. Students may find themselves grappling with a heavy course load and tight deadlines, which can lead to increased stress and burnout. It’s important for students considering a 1 year A Level program to carefully assess their ability to handle the demands of such a fast-paced curriculum.

Another potential downside of the 1 year A Level program is the lack of time for extracurricular activities and personal development. In a traditional two-year program, students have more opportunity to participate in clubs, sports, and other activities outside of their academic studies. By completing their A Levels in just one year, students may miss out on these valuable experiences that can help them develop important skills and interests.

Furthermore, some universities and employers may view a 1 year A Level program less favorably than a traditional two-year program. Admissions officers and hiring managers may question whether students who completed their A Levels in just one year have truly mastered the material or if they simply rushed through their studies to meet a deadline. This could potentially put students at a disadvantage when applying to competitive universities or job positions.

Despite these challenges, it is indeed possible to successfully complete A Levels in just one year with the right approach and dedication. Students who are considering a 1 year A Level program should be prepared to work hard, stay organized, and seek support from teachers, tutors, and classmates. Developing good study habits, time management skills, and stress-coping strategies will be essential for thriving in an accelerated program.

Mastering Airway Management: The Importance Of Advanced Airway Courses

In the field of emergency medicine, the ability to effectively manage a patient’s airway is a crucial skill that can mean the difference between life and death. When a patient’s airway is compromised, whether due to trauma, illness, or other factors, immediate intervention is necessary to ensure that oxygen reaches the lungs and vital organs. This is where advanced airway courses come into play, offering healthcare providers the opportunity to hone their skills and build confidence in managing complex airway emergencies.

advanced airway courses are designed for healthcare professionals who have a basic understanding of airway management but are looking to further develop their knowledge and skills. These courses typically cover a range of topics, including advanced airway anatomy, techniques for intubation and extubation, use of specialized airway devices, and strategies for managing difficult airways. Participants learn how to assess a patient’s airway, determine the appropriate intervention, and respond quickly and effectively in emergency situations.

One of the key benefits of advanced airway courses is that they provide hands-on training in a simulated clinical environment. This allows participants to practice their skills in a safe and controlled setting, under the guidance of experienced instructors. Through realistic scenarios and interactive workshops, healthcare providers can strengthen their airway management techniques and build confidence in their ability to handle complex cases.

In addition to hands-on training, advanced airway courses also offer participants the opportunity to learn about the latest advancements in airway management technology. From video laryngoscopes to supraglottic airway devices, participants are introduced to a range of tools and techniques that can help improve patient outcomes and reduce the risk of complications during airway procedures. By staying up-to-date with the latest advancements in airway management, healthcare providers can enhance their clinical practice and deliver high-quality care to their patients.

Another important aspect of advanced airway courses is the emphasis on teamwork and communication. In a clinical setting, airway management often requires collaboration between healthcare providers from different disciplines, including physicians, nurses, and respiratory therapists. advanced airway courses teach participants how to work effectively as a team, delegate responsibilities, and communicate clearly and efficiently during airway procedures. By fostering a culture of collaboration and teamwork, these courses help ensure that patients receive the best possible care during airway emergencies.

Furthermore, advanced airway courses can help healthcare providers develop critical thinking skills and enhance their decision-making abilities. When faced with a patient with a compromised airway, healthcare providers must be able to quickly assess the situation, determine the appropriate intervention, and adapt to changing circumstances. advanced airway courses teach participants how to think on their feet, make quick and effective decisions, and troubleshoot problems that may arise during airway procedures. By honing their critical thinking skills, healthcare providers can improve patient outcomes and provide more efficient and effective care.
